New Moon Blessings and the Return of Forward Motion: Respite Amidst Challenges.

9/12/2020

0 Comments

 
(From the Know to Flow Forecast for Consciously Creating Life, Vol. 75, Week of September 14th, 2020.)
On Saturday, September 12th, Jupiter stationed direct after being retrograde in Capricorn all summer.  This is the first of three planets (Jupiter, Saturn, and Pluto) in Capricorn stationing direct between now and October 4th.  They all stationed retrograde in April/May.  
PictureArt by Stephanie Law
Jupiter is the planet of growth and expansion, so with it now direct we will feel like there is a little more space in our lives and in the world to move and breathe.  Jupiter is also the planet of belief, philosophy, and personal truths.  During its time retrograde, we have had the opportunity to review our beliefs and core truths.  Now we may be emerging with a revised view of the world around us and how we relate to it and fit in to it.  

Saturn, ruler of karma, lessons, challenges, obstacles, time, boundaries, limits, rules, authority, responsibility, and restriction will turn direct on September 28th.  Then Pluto stations direct on October 4th, wrapping our review of power dynamics and how our relationship to them is rooted in our deep psyche.  With these shifts, we are truly beginning to feel a sense of release - like things are sorting out and we are slowly regaining forward momentum.  

However, with Mars having recently stationed retrograde in Aries on September 9th, we won't be completely out of the woods with all of this until after it stations direct November 13th.   Mars will be challenging Saturn and Pluto in Capricorn, bringing up older themes we are finishing up with now.  Within Mars' retrograde, Mercury, the messenger and ruler of the mind and communications, will be retrograde in Scorpio and Libra from October 13th to November 3rd (election day here in the U.S.).  Aries and Libra form one of the six axes of the zodiac, so Mercury in Libra will be tangling with Mars as well during this time. 

So, yes, things are looking up!  And...we have a little bit more navigation ahead, until we get past that big shift on November 13th.  But its not without purpose.  We may be feeling worn down, but this is part of this process of growth and transformation. We are building great strength and fortitude now.  Pay attention to the areas of life the challenges feel the greatest - that will give you more insight as to where the lessons and growth are as well.  (These areas of life will be represented by the houses ruled in your chart by Aries and Capricorn.)

This Thursday's new moon in Virgo (September 17th at 5 a.m., MDT) is getting a boost from ruler of Virgo, Mercury, in aspect to Jupiter in Capricorn. This is coming just on the heels of Jupiter stationing direct, and so feels even more expansive.

There is more on this below in the daily notes, but new moons are fresh starts, Virgo rules healing, details, health, and day-to-day routines, and rituals for well-being, and Jupiter is beliefs, philosophy, spirituality, religion, growth, and expansion. 

Jupiter is freshly direct in Capricorn - what new truths and beliefs have been discovered over the summer during its retrograde that we are now ready to use to create the foundation of our lives? 

​We can harness the power of this new moon by identifying these, and implementing a behavior that supports them into our daily routine.  To anchor a new belief, we must incorporate supporting behavior into our daily lives, and new habits and routines are where Virgo shines!

Next week on the 23rd and 24th, we hit more bumps as Mercury begins its retrograde pre-shadow in square to Saturn still retrograde in Capricorn, and then opposes Mars retrograde in Aries.  On the 28th, Saturn stations direct, which is the beginning of even more forward momentum, but it does so in square to Mars retrograde in Aries, which is going to feel like a big roadblock.  We will be working this out during the remainder of Mars retrograde until November 13th.
